最新下载
热门教程
-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 8
- 9
- 10
JAVA:数据库操作封装
时间:2022-07-02 18:16:05 编辑:袖梨 来源:一聚教程网
package creator.common.db;
import java.io.InputStream;
import java.sql.*;
import javax.sql.*;
import javax.naming.*;
/**
*
*
*
*
*
* @author TanBo
* @version 1.0
*/
public class DbBean {
public java.sql.Connection conn = null; //connection object
public ResultSet rs = null; //resultset object
public Statement stmt = null; //statement object
public PreparedStatement prepstmt = null; //preparedstatement object
private String drivers = null; //connection parameter:drivers
private String url = null; //connection parameter:url
private String user = null; //connection parameter:user
private String password = null; //connection parameter:password
private String jndi_name = null; //connection pool parameter:jndi name
/**
* init()
*/
public DbBean(){
try{
//parameter init
drivers = creator.config.ConfigBundle.getString("drivers");
url = creator.config.ConfigBundle.getString("url");
user = creator.config.ConfigBundle.getString("user");
password = creator.config.ConfigBundle.getString("password");
jndi_name = creator.config.ConfigBundle.getString("jndi_name");
//db connection pool init
//InitialContext env = new InitialContext();
//javax.sql.DataSource pool = (javax.sql.DataSource)env.lookup(jndi_name);
//conn = pool.getConnection();
//db connection init
Class.forName(drivers);
conn = DriverManager.getConnection(url,user,password);
//db statement init
stmt = conn.createStatement();
}catch(Exception e){
System.out.println("dbBean: init error!"+e.toString());
import java.io.InputStream;
import java.sql.*;
import javax.sql.*;
import javax.naming.*;
/**
*
*
Title: dbBean.java
*
Description:
*
Copyright: Copyright (c) 2004
*
Company:
* @author TanBo
* @version 1.0
*/
public class DbBean {
public java.sql.Connection conn = null; //connection object
public ResultSet rs = null; //resultset object
public Statement stmt = null; //statement object
public PreparedStatement prepstmt = null; //preparedstatement object
private String drivers = null; //connection parameter:drivers
private String url = null; //connection parameter:url
private String user = null; //connection parameter:user
private String password = null; //connection parameter:password
private String jndi_name = null; //connection pool parameter:jndi name
/**
* init()
*/
public DbBean(){
try{
//parameter init
drivers = creator.config.ConfigBundle.getString("drivers");
url = creator.config.ConfigBundle.getString("url");
user = creator.config.ConfigBundle.getString("user");
password = creator.config.ConfigBundle.getString("password");
jndi_name = creator.config.ConfigBundle.getString("jndi_name");
//db connection pool init
//InitialContext env = new InitialContext();
//javax.sql.DataSource pool = (javax.sql.DataSource)env.lookup(jndi_name);
//conn = pool.getConnection();
//db connection init
Class.forName(drivers);
conn = DriverManager.getConnection(url,user,password);
//db statement init
stmt = conn.createStatement();
}catch(Exception e){
System.out.println("dbBean: init error!"+e.toString());
相关文章
- 笑傲江湖OL官网首页入口 笑傲江湖OL官方网站 04-08
- 扶摇一梦官网首页入口 扶摇一梦官方网站 04-08
- classin官网入口网址 classin官网登录入口 04-08
- 代号妖鬼势力阵容如何搭配 04-08
- 红月传奇礼包码输入位置在哪 04-08
- 星露谷物语如何获取鹦鹉螺 04-08